Washington Police releases photo of Cascade Mall gunman who killed 4 people

The Washington State Patrol said on Twitter that three people had died in the Cascade Mall shooting.

Washington State Patrol spokesperson released pictures of the Washington mall attacker where four people have been shot dead. Sgt. Mark Francis took to Twitter to share the picture of the gunman requesting any information on him. He also said three females were killed, one male suffered life-threatening injuries and another female suffered non-life threatening injuries at the Cascade Mall in Burlington

Francis also said the sole gunman, who was last seen walking towards Interstate 5, is armed with a rifle. The attacker had reportedly left the mall before police arrived.

Skagit County Department of Emergency Management confirmed that the attacker, dressed in black tshirt, was a Hispanic male and the authorities were currently looking for him.

He also requested people to avoid Burlington Boulevard, I5 near Highway 20. Law enforcement agencies have asked people to stay inside and immediately report any suspicious activities.
